The “ChildTALK: Children Teaching and Learning for and by Kids”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) 2023 is a comprehensive guide designed to help children learn about their rights. This is developed by AHRC law student interns, with inputs and suggestions from children of Unang Hakbang Foundation (UHF) and Barangay Child Representatives of Mandaluyong City. This guide contains information on a variety of topics related to significant issues that children are currently facing, which are: (1) Basic Children’s Rights, (2) Online Sexual Abuse and Exploitation of Children (OSAEC), (3) Sexual Orientation and Gender Identity and Expression (SOGIE), (4) Cyberbullying, (5) Mental Health, (6) Adolescent Dating and Pregnancy, and (7) Climate Change and Climate Justice. The FAQs are also a resource for children to seek help or guidance if they feel their rights are being violated. This material is primarily intended for Filipino children aged 10-16 years old, and is written in Tagalog/English and in a child-friendly language. #AKAP #ChildTALK #ChildRights #ChildProtection
